Semiconductor back-end equipment encompasses a suite of advanced machinery used in the final stages of semiconductor manufacturing, where processed silicon wafers are transformed into fully functional integrated circuits (ICs) ready for deployment in electronic devices. This back-end process begins after front-end wafer fabrication and involves key steps such as dicing, which slices the wafer into individual dies; die bonding, where each die is mounted onto a substrate or lead frame; and wire bonding or flip-chip bonding, which establish the electrical interconnections between the die and the package.
Subsequent steps include encapsulation or packaging, where the die is enclosed in protective materials to safeguard it from physical damage, moisture, and thermal stress. These steps are critical to ensure the final product's mechanical integrity and thermal performance. Testing and inspection systems are integrated throughout the process to measure critical dimensions, identify defects, and verify the electrical functionality of the devices. Back-end equipment must deliver exceptional precision, speed, and automation to meet the stringent performance and reliability standards demanded by sectors such as consumer electronics, automotive, telecommunications, and industrial automation. As chips become smaller and more complex, the role of advanced back-end equipment in enabling high yield, cost-effective production has become increasingly vital to the global semiconductor supply chain.

The growing global demand for semiconductors across industries such as consumer electronics, automotive, healthcare, and industrial automation is significantly driving the need for expanded production capacity and more advanced back-end packaging technologies. As electronic devices continue to shrink while requiring greater performance and functionality, the industry is shifting toward sophisticated packaging methods like fan-out wafer-level packaging (FOWLP), 2.5D/3D integration, and system-in-package (SiP). These approaches not only enhance performance and density but also place greater demands on back-end semiconductor equipment for higher precision, flexibility, and automation. This trend is further amplified by the increasing complexity of integrated circuits and the push for miniaturization, which require tighter process tolerances and more advanced capabilities in die bonding, wire bonding, and packaging. Sectors such as automotive and medical electronics, which require extremely high levels of reliability and performance, rely heavily on advanced metrology and inspection systems to maintain stringent quality standards throughout the back-end process.
At the same time, the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) into back-end operations is transforming the manufacturing landscape. These technologies enable real-time process optimization, predictive maintenance, and yield improvement, enhancing overall operational efficiency. Moreover, sustainability concerns are encouraging the development of energy-efficient, environmentally friendly equipment to reduce water and chemical usage, emissions, and overall environmental impact. Despite these advances, the high capital investment required for state-of-the-art back-end systems remains a major hurdle, particularly for small and mid-sized enterprises. Additionally, the increasing technical complexity of back-end processes necessitates a skilled workforce, which poses challenges for scaling operations quickly and effectively.

The semiconductor back-end equipment industry is intensely competitive, shaped by a mix of dominant global players and agile niche firms that are pushing the boundaries of innovation. With the growing complexity of semiconductor devices and the industry's transition toward advanced packaging and ultra-miniaturized components, equipment manufacturers are under increasing pressure to deliver highly precise, efficient, and reliable solutions. Key focus areas include cutting-edge technologies in metrology, inspection, dicing, bonding, and assembly systems—each critical to ensuring quality and performance in final chip production. Leading companies are investing heavily in research and development to stay ahead of technological trends and meet the evolving demands of chipmakers. Strategic initiatives such as mergers and acquisitions, joint ventures, and international expansion are commonly pursued to broaden product offerings, enhance technical capabilities, and capture market share across emerging and established regions.
Additionally, there is a growing emphasis on end-to-end service models and fully integrated equipment platforms. These comprehensive solutions not only streamline operations but also enable semiconductor manufacturers to improve yield, reduce downtime, and lower total cost of ownership. As the pace of innovation accelerates and customer requirements become more specialized, the ability to offer customized, scalable, and service-oriented solutions has become a key competitive differentiator in the back-end semiconductor equipment landscape.
